We rented a car and ended up in Koloa many times over the 5 days we were on Kauai. The first time, we were too early for the shops to be open and we just wandered quietly and got some coffee and hit the historic market (that is now stealthily an ABC store). We came back again during business hours and wandered around even more. The history of the area is very interesting if you read the plaques on the buildings.

Cute little town, well maintained with an assortment of gift shops, art galleries and places to grab a snack or a meal. Century old buildings have plaques with information about the structures. Lovely, very large monkey pod tree with twisted limbs. Fun place to stroll around for an hour or so.

There are some small shops, restaurants and stores in Old Koloa Town. There are plenty of places to explore and a small memorial park.
Koloa is home to a great farmers market at noon on Mondays. It is where the first mill for sugar cane was built and the buildings still make a wonderful photo opportunity.
